Is Your Netflix Account Hacked? Here’s How to Find Out

Direct Answer

If you’re wondering if your Netflix account has been hacked, look out for these immediate signs:
– Unusual viewing activity
– Unknown devices logged in
– Changed account settings or password
– Unrecognized payment methods or charges

Step-by-Step Guide to Check Your Account

1. **Sign in to your account**: Go to Netflix.com and log in as you normally would.
2. **Review recent activity**: Check the “Recent device streaming activity” section to see if there are any unrecognized devices or viewing activities.
3. **Check account settings**: Go to “Account” and then “Account settings” to verify your personal and payment information.
4. **Verify profiles**: Ensure all profiles are familiar and no new ones have been added without your knowledge.
5. **Look for suspicious emails**: Check your email inbox for any emails from Netflix that you didn’t request, such as password reset emails.
6. **Run a virus scan**: Run a virus scan on your devices to detect any malware that might be used to hack into your account.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. **Q: What should I do if I find out my account is hacked?**
A: Immediately change your password, sign out of all devices, and review your account settings for any changes.
2. **Q: Can I prevent my Netflix account from being hacked?**
A: Yes, by using strong, unique passwords, enabling two-factor authentication, and regularly checking your account activity.
3. **Q: How can I contact Netflix if I think my account has been hacked?**
A: You can contact Netflix through their help center or by calling their customer support number.
